Output e043764d86ea31865393c93c3c2018f209cd4a31d0ce200b95da2f154acfe362:0

value
1382100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3758973a67deb83f53f8771eb24982e70d6ea83a OP_EQUALVERIFY OP_CHECKSIG
address
163eHwgk727UzU6LbpheuPNaF3jYc3xFLr
transaction
e043764d86ea31865393c93c3c2018f209cd4a31d0ce200b95da2f154acfe362
spent
true